Tempe is one of the traditional Indonesian foods that is very popular in the country and around the world. Tempe is made from soybeans that have been fermented, and it is a staple food in many Indonesian households. The process of making tempe is very simple, and it can be done at home with just a few ingredients. In this article, we will show you how to make tempe, step-by-step.


The ingredients you will need to make tempe are:

  • 500 grams of soybeans
  • 2 tablespoons of tempe starter (or ragi tempe)


Step 1: Soak the Soybeans

The first step in making tempe is to soak the soybeans. You should soak the soybeans in water for around 8-10 hours, or overnight. After soaking, drain the water.

Step 2: Steam the Soybeans

After soaking, steam the soybeans for around 30-45 minutes until they are fully cooked. You can use a steamer or a pressure cooker to steam the soybeans.

Step 3: Cool the Soybeans

After steaming, let the soybeans cool down to room temperature. You can spread them out on a clean cloth or a tray to cool them down faster.

Step 4: Add the Tempe Starter

Once the soybeans have cooled down, you can add the tempe starter (ragi tempe) to the soybeans and mix them well. Make sure that the tempe starter is evenly distributed throughout the soybeans.

Step 5: Incubate the Soybeans

After mixing the soybeans and the tempe starter, you can put them in a container and cover it with a clean cloth. Place the container in a warm place with good air circulation. You can use a rice cooker, an oven, or a special tempe incubator to incubate the soybeans.

Step 6: Wait for the Tempe to Ferment

The fermentation process will take around 24-48 hours. During this time, the soybeans will be covered with a white, fluffy mycelium. This is the sign that the tempe is ready to be consumed.

Step 7: Store the Tempe

After the fermentation process is complete, you can remove the tempe from the container and store it in the refrigerator. You can store tempe for up to 1 week in the refrigerator.


Tempe is a nutritious food that is high in protein, fiber, and vitamins. It is also low in fat and cholesterol. One serving of tempe (100 grams) contains:

  • Calories: 193
  • Protein: 18.2 grams
  • Fat: 9.4 grams
  • Carbohydrates: 9.5 grams
  • Fiber: 7.5 grams
  • Iron: 1.8 mg
  • Calcium: 139 mg


Making tempe is a simple and easy process that can be done at home with just a few ingredients. Tempe is a nutritious food that is high in protein and low in fat and cholesterol. By making your own tempe, you can ensure that it is fresh, healthy, and free from any additives or preservatives. So why not give it a try and make your own tempe at home today?

